Forecasted Texas peak of coronavirus outbreak earlier than expected

The new projected peak of the coronavirus outbreak in Texas is less than two weeks away, sooner than expected.  Data from the Institute for Health Metrics and Evaluation at the University of Washington School of Medicine say the peak will be on April 19th.  The peak was originally forecast for May 2nd.  Dr. Peter Hotez, […]

Checkpoints set up to screen people driving into Texas from Louisiana

Texas state troopers are now manning checkpoints at the Texas-Louisiana line to screen people driving in from the Pelican State.  Inbound drivers are required to fill out a form telling where they plan to self-quarantine for two-weeks, which is now mandatory for people arriving from Louisiana.  The form also asks for driver’s license info so […]

Gov. Abbott addresses hospital readiness

Governor Greg Abbott says the number of hospital beds in Texas is increasing.  During a news conference at the Capitol on Friday night, Abbott said the number of beds has increased 15-percent, making over 19-thousand-600 beds available statewide.  Over two-thousand intensive care beds are available as well.  Abbott also addressed the growing concern about ventilators, […]
